What is Kemira Oyj PEG Ratio?

PE Ratio without NRI / 5-Year EBITDA Growth Rate*

PEG Ratio is defined as the PE Ratio without NRI divided by the growth ratio. The growth rate we use is the 5-Year EBITDA growth rate. As of today, Kemira Oyj's PE Ratio without NRI is 14.68. Kemira Oyj's 5-Year EBITDA growth rate is 10.80%. Therefore, Kemira Oyj's PEG Ratio for today is 1.36.

* The 5-Year EBITDA Growth Rate is the 5-year average EBITDA per share growth rate. While the denominator is a percentage, we use the whole number as opposed to the decimal form for the calculation. For example, 5% would be shown as 5 as opposed to 0.05. If it's smaller than or equal to 0, then the PEG Ratio is not calculated.

Kemira Oyj  (OTCPK:KOYJF) PEG Ratio Explanation

To compare stocks with different growth rates, Peter Lynch invented a ratio called PEG Ratio. PEG Ratio is defined as the P/E ratio divided by the growth ratio. He thinks a company with a P/E ratio equal to its growth rate is fairly valued. Still he said he would rather buy a company growing 20% a year with a P/E of 20, instead of a company growing 10% a year with a P/E of 10.

Kemira Oyj offers sustainable chemical solutions for water-intensive industries. The company provides best-suited products and expertise to improve its customers' product quality, process, and resource efficiency. It focuses on pulp and paper, water treatment, and oil and gas industries.
